Oklahoma City Police and Animal Welfare are investigating after four dogs were found dead in Edwards park in the northeastern part of the city.

Oklahoma City Animal Welfare said the four dogs were Pitbull mixes ranging from under a year old to four years old, and they are confident the dogs belonged to someone. 

OCPD said the animals were found tied to a heavy object such as a brick or cinder block. 

While no other dogs have been found in the past two weeks, authorities said they are still looking for whoever has done this. 

"Whoever is doing this, is taking the dogs out to the pier there at the pond in the park and simply throwing them off the pier," OCPD Crime Stoppers Manager MSgt. Jennifer Wardlow said. "We want to put this out there in hopes someone who lives in the area saw something suspicious."
